Transaction 64c91f521859f1d24224e514a29a24751b2597020eee66d05fc2c0669dc9ca66

1 Input
2 Outputs
  • 64c91f521859f1d24224e514a29a24751b2597020eee66d05fc2c0669dc9ca66:0
  • value  489893905
    address  34YApAL8RfaVaSHpkyVUXYKDCBrqvq9jE5
  • 64c91f521859f1d24224e514a29a24751b2597020eee66d05fc2c0669dc9ca66:1
  • value  1077106735
    address  1Dn8zXExDUmBvbvVjrDTUP1QUSSPH65z4U